Get in Touch** The Honda repair market for Coalfield, Tennessee residents is characterized by limited *in-town* options, necessitating travel to nearby commercial centers for specialized service. The closest and most direct option is the dealership in Oak Ridge (~25-minute drive), which sets the benchmark for OEM-standard work and handles the most complex computer and hybrid system issues. The broader region, including Knoxville and Kingston, offers highly competent independent specialists who often provide more personalized service and potentially lower labor rates. Competition is healthy among these top-tier providers, driving a high standard of quality. Typical pricing follows a clear tier: dealership labor rates are the highest, followed by specialized independents in Knoxville, with local general shops in areas like Kingston offering the most budget-friendly rates for standard maintenance and repairs. For a resident of Coalfield, the choice often balances the need for factory-certified expertise against cost and travel distance.

Given our hilly terrain and seasonal temperature swings, common issues include premature brake wear, suspension component stress, and battery strain. For older Honda models popular locally, like the Civic and Accord, watch for aging ignition switches and power window regulator failures, which are frequent repair items.
Look for a shop with certified Honda technicians or strong Asian import specialization, as general mechanics may lack model-specific expertise. Always request a detailed written estimate upfront to avoid surprises, as parts costs for Hondas are relatively consistent, but labor can vary.
Seek immediate service at a Coalfield-area shop if the light is flashing, which indicates a severe misfire that can damage the catalytic converter—a costly repair. A solid light also warrants a prompt diagnostic scan, especially before longer drives on winding routes like Highway 62, to prevent a potential breakdown.
Our rural roads and winter conditions mean you should prioritize tire inspections and alignments more frequently to handle potholes and gravel. Also, consider more regular undercarriage checks for corrosion if you frequently drive on salted roads in winter or live on one of the area's many unpaved roads.
